This topic is closely connected to a variety of property-related problems and planning efforts. For many, the primary motivation is to prevent water damage or flooding, especially in areas prone to heavy rain or poor drainage. Proper grading helps direct water away from foundations, basements, and walkways, reducing the risk of costly repairs later. It also plays a role in preparing a site for landscaping, patios, or new construction, where a level or appropriately sloped surface is essential. Homeowners often consider grading when planning yard renovations, installing driveways, or addressing existing issues like erosion or uneven terrain. The work of experienced service providers ensures these plans are executed correctly, providing a foundation for a stable and functional outdoor space.

The types of properties that typically require professional grading span a broad range. Residential homes with yards that experience drainage problems or uneven surfaces are common candidates. These might include properties with sloped land that causes water to flow toward the house or areas where the ground has settled over time. Larger properties, such as farms or estates, often need grading to manage extensive land areas and ensure proper water flow across fields or gardens. Commercial properties, including parking lots and retail centers, also benefit from professional grading to maintain proper drainage and prevent pooling that could impact safety or accessibility. Regardless of the property size or type, the goal remains the same: to create a stable, well-drained environment that supports the property’s intended use and longevity.
